Output 8e23b939a1879be1d6563f7e5817b1f77257f36063f5c33eae64fff2d2bb874a:45

value
988880
script pubkey
OP_0 OP_PUSHBYTES_20 e29c7fb6c80f6d1f0921b6e9cf993d56307d2754
address
bc1qu2w8ldkgpak37zfpkm5ulxfa2cc86f65khv7s9
transaction
8e23b939a1879be1d6563f7e5817b1f77257f36063f5c33eae64fff2d2bb874a